From patchwork Thu Sep 19 15:38:17 2019 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Alex Deucher X-Patchwork-Id: 11152825 Return-Path: Received: from mail.kernel.org (pdx-korg-mail-1.web.codeaurora.org [172.30.200.123]) by pdx-korg-patchwork-2.web.codeaurora.org (Postfix) with ESMTP id E66FA112B for ; Thu, 19 Sep 2019 15:39:02 +0000 (UTC) Received: from gabe.freedesktop.org (gabe.freedesktop.org [131.252.210.177]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id CE88421924 for ; Thu, 19 Sep 2019 15:39:02 +0000 (UTC) D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org CE88421924 Authentication-Results: mail.kernel.org; dmarc=fail (p=none dis=none) header.from=gmail.com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=dri-devel-bounces@lists.freedesktop.org Received: from gabe.freedesktop.org (localhost [127.0.0.1]) by gabe.freedesktop.org (Postfix) with ESMTP id 020C96F835; Thu, 19 Sep 2019 15:39:02 +0000 (UTC) X-Original-To: dri-devel@lists.freedesktop.org Delivered-To: dri-devel@lists.freedesktop.org Received: from mail-qt1-x82d.google.com (mail-qt1-x82d.google.com [IPv6:2607:f8b0:4864:20::82d]) by gabe.freedesktop.org (Postfix) with ESMTPS id 991916F835; Thu, 19 Sep 2019 15:39:00 +0000 (UTC) Received: by mail-qt1-x82d.google.com with SMTP id x4so4755930qtq.8; Thu, 19 Sep 2019 08:39:00 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:mime-version :content-transfer-encoding; bh=n6dg/DewGh8JEWpXTm/SYKez7jm24tCf0mg4kVIkFKw=; b=Z1wcR4IViJ6JCGCxUbBNSPHKnDO3v4pZ8/bpHcXvOHv6J3ngmzfQbky7Ci35Decsv8 U7LFm774rD9GFUpIlkjVK3zUdPXTsCorzjVQgNIE9ZU8GR3pjWQMMwV1bn/mUeQYSWqX 5iNoxLzhoowFyv3ySnjc3lef8bQA33NWmjkA+r79kSXyJMAeiWX2TY8Nr0Map9mSNPkP Jj8BS0TGE3qeLMAza2kqgljQ6QH5DIsnlko3z58PcTwzHig8deTWoJILS57VMvD57zLP fmo2/g7N0M2j6cUlRPFbJsOlVjXefdoh/5flrYnj4wNSrsoBK3tH1vKruhKH9DFx5zyk KV5w== X-Gm-Message-State: APjAAAWdOw1mPCDyQUV0WoVXGp9f9xt2/mutC2WEykZLwxZKpKg86a86 2d4PhJ/iiHw9zJp1yb6iFO/fZzOv X-Google-Smtp-Source: APXvYqzt4RA14s2TV58vyRon9JhknBxTva8E+M/paykytt8yAoQd/IHe1HrHMa1dsJ8XbKjQQEij6Q== X-Received: by 2002:ac8:368b:: with SMTP id a11mr3779254qtc.47.1568907539368; Thu, 19 Sep 2019 08:38:59 -0700 (PDT) Received: from localhost.localdomain ([71.219.73.178]) by smtp.gmail.com with ESMTPSA id q49sm5946811qta.60.2019.09.19.08.38.58 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Thu, 19 Sep 2019 08:38:58 -0700 (PDT) From: Alex Deucher X-Google-Original-From: Alex Deucher To: amd-gfx@lists.freedesktop.org, dri-devel@lists.freedesktop.org, airlied@gmail.com, daniel.vetter@ffwll.ch Subject: [pull] amdgpu drm-fixes-5.4 Date: Thu, 19 Sep 2019 10:38:17 -0500 Message-Id: <20190919153817.3615-1-alexander.deucher@amd.com> X-Mailer: git-send-email 2.20.1 MIME-Version: 1.0 X-Mailman-Original-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=from:to:cc:subject:date:message-id:mime-version :content-transfer-encoding; bh=n6dg/DewGh8JEWpXTm/SYKez7jm24tCf0mg4kVIkFKw=; b=pj4QrDKx3A9abBlZfMygexfZW8512cQl/5eOsB/lSj9j0JFd3luAEhyRr/oxBuwINL UvJGI6lO/9VsdA9IR3ZHNjnkNU7H2PNt9OFz3D785ipBRMIFe7yO9vQeC+X92T8cw+kk GC5H0rgZNsEfZMcWI1IQwWyrew2MDgFDgSNbjXTk1QTdqA03yWTuRMxN8KlxDXj9D8pq nNcSKig7HrqRviFX2xoSUCXU2ODfT+OhQ7He653bvZYONBF6EpL3einyaTzH303tXFR7 D/UMKzN4u/0ANgbImFFAPDqSzrF9K16qOjkBz2mOcZK6UI1KQz6Zea7WCPtt5H2W1WDu 2Svg== X-BeenThere: dri-devel@lists.freedesktop.org X-Mailman-Version: 2.1.23 Precedence: list List-Id: Direct Rendering Infrastructure - Development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Alex Deucher Errors-To: dri-devel-bounces@lists.freedesktop.org Sender: "dri-devel" Hi Dave, Daniel, A few fixes for 5.4. The following changes since commit 945b584c94f8c665b2df3834a8a6a8faf256cd5f: Merge branch 'linux-5.4' of git://github.com/skeggsb/linux into drm-next (2019-09-17 16:31:34 +1000) are available in the Git repository at: git://people.freedesktop.org/~agd5f/linux tags/drm-fixes-5.4-2019-09-19 for you to fetch changes up to e16a7cbced7110866dcde84e504909ea85099bbd: drm/amdgpu: flag navi12 and 14 as experimental for 5.4 (2019-09-18 08:29:30 -0500) ---------------------------------------------------------------- drm-fixes-5.4-2019-09-19: amdgpu: - Add more navi12 and navi14 PCI ids - Misc fixes for renoir - Fix bandwidth issues with multiple displays on vega20 - Support for Dali - Fix a possible oops with KFD on hawaii - Fix for backlight level after resume on some APUs - Other misc fixes ---------------------------------------------------------------- Aaron Liu (3): drm/amdgpu: disable stutter mode for renoir drm/amd/display: update renoir_ip_offset.h drm/amdgpu: remove program of lbpw for renoir Alex Deucher (1): drm/amdgpu: flag navi12 and 14 as experimental for 5.4 Andrey Grodzovsky (2): drm/amdgpu: Add smu lock around in pp_smu_i2c_bus_access drm/amdgpu: Remove clock gating restore. Bhawanpreet Lakha (2): drm/amd/display: add Asic ID for Dali drm/amd/display: Implement voltage limitation for dali Charlene Liu (1): drm/amd/display: dce11.x /dce12 update formula input Felix Kuehling (1): drm/amdgpu: Fix KFD-related kernel oops on Hawaii Hans de Goede (1): drm/radeon: Bail earlier when radeon.cik_/si_support=0 is passed Jay Cornwall (1): drm/amdkfd: Swap trap temporary registers in gfx10 trap handler Kai-Heng Feng (1): drm/amd/display: Restore backlight brightness after system resume Prike Liang (2): drm/amd/amdgpu: power up sdma engine when S3 resume back drm/amd/powerplay: implement sysfs for getting dpm clock Roman Li (1): drm/amd/display: Add stereo mux and dig programming calls for dcn21 Tianci.Yin (2): drm/amdgpu: add navi14 PCI ID for work station SKU drm/amdgpu: add navi12 pci id Trek (1): drm/amdgpu: Check for valid number of registers to read Zhan Liu (1): drm/amd/display: Add missing HBM support and raise Vega20's uclk. drivers/gpu/drm/amd/amdgpu/amdgpu_dpm.c | 2 +- drivers/gpu/drm/amd/amdgpu/amdgpu_drv.c | 7 ++- drivers/gpu/drm/amd/amdgpu/amdgpu_ib.c | 3 +- drivers/gpu/drm/amd/amdgpu/amdgpu_kms.c | 3 + drivers/gpu/drm/amd/amdgpu/gfx_v9_0.c | 2 - drivers/gpu/drm/amd/amdgpu/sdma_v4_0.c | 10 ++-- drivers/gpu/drm/amd/amdgpu/smu_v11_0_i2c.c | 10 +++- drivers/gpu/drm/amd/amdkfd/cwsr_trap_handler.h | 6 +- .../gpu/drm/amd/amdkfd/cwsr_trap_handler_gfx10.asm | 10 ++-- dr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c | 3 + drivers/gpu/drm/amd/display/dc/calcs/dcn_calcs.c | 4 ++ .../amd/display/dc/clk_mgr/dce110/dce110_clk_mgr.c | 25 ++++++-- drivers/gpu/drm/amd/display/dc/dce/dce_mem_input.c | 4 +- .../drm/amd/display/dc/dce112/dce112_resource.c | 16 +++-- .../drm/amd/display/dc/dce120/dce120_resource.c | 11 +++- .../amd/display/dc/gpio/dcn21/hw_factory_dcn21.c | 38 +++++++++++- .../amd/display/dc/gpio/dcn21/hw_translate_dcn21.c | 3 +- drivers/gpu/drm/amd/display/dc/inc/resource.h | 2 + drivers/gpu/drm/amd/display/include/dal_asic_id.h | 7 ++- drivers/gpu/drm/amd/include/renoir_ip_offset.h | 2 +- drivers/gpu/drm/amd/powerplay/amd_powerplay.c | 7 ++- drivers/gpu/drm/amd/powerplay/amdgpu_smu.c | 3 + drivers/gpu/drm/amd/powerplay/renoir_ppt.c | 70 ++++++++++++++++++++++ drivers/gpu/drm/amd/powerplay/renoir_ppt.h | 25 ++++++++ drivers/gpu/drm/radeon/radeon_drv.c | 31 ++++++++++ drivers/gpu/drm/radeon/radeon_kms.c | 25 -------- 26 files changed, 262 insertions(+), 67 deletions(-)